Podcast Insights
Content Themes
The podcast focuses on various topics related to womanhood, including inner healing, personal growth, and the challenges of balancing multiple roles. Episodes cover themes such as grieving during the holidays, the pressures of societal beauty standards, and the complexities of relationships, with specific discussions on 'Women Who Bounce Back' and 'Healing From Heartbreak.'

Hi guys, and welcome to Girl Talk One-on-One. I’m your host, Nicole D. Miller, and we are in the midst of a powerful discussion with Jenna Edwards. Jenna shares with us her miraculous story of overcoming a health crisis, a mental health crisis, and devastating life-altering circumstances.
Jenna was in the 2003 Santa Monica Farmer’s Market crash, a nationally known, horrific event that changed the trajectory of her life. One that she was lucky to have survived, which killed several and injured many.
